Do you sometimes feel tired, lethargic and spiritless? How can Ayurveda help in a simple, practisable manner? Time is scarce and precious in today's world, and we seek solutions that are quick. While allopathic medicine tends to focus on the management of disease, the ancient study of dinacharya provides us with holistic knowledge of preventing disease and eliminating its root cause. Taking us through a day in the life of Ayurveda living, Dr Bhaswati Bhattacharya illustrates the core principles of Ayurveda and shows us how to incorporate these in our routine. She explains the logic behind the changes she recommends and how they benefit us. Informative and accessible, Everyday Ayurveda is the perfect lifestyle guide designed to maximize health, longevity and happiness the natural way.

What will you learn from this book

  1. Understanding Ayurveda: The book provides an introduction to Ayurveda, an ancient system of medicine from India, and explains its principles of balancing the body, mind, and spirit.

  2. Doshas and Body Types: Ayurveda categorizes individuals into different body types or doshas (Vata, Pitta, and Kapha) based on their unique constitution and characteristics. Understanding one's dosha can help tailor lifestyle practices for optimal health.

  3. Balancing Diet and Nutrition: Ayurveda emphasizes the importance of a balanced diet tailored to one's dosha. The book provides guidance on selecting foods that support overall health and well-being, including seasonal eating and mindful eating practices.

  4. Daily Routines (Dinacharya): Establishing daily routines aligned with natural rhythms is key in Ayurveda. The book outlines various daily practices, or dinacharya, such as waking up early, oil pulling, tongue scraping, and meditation, to promote health and vitality.

  5. Yoga and Exercise: Ayurveda advocates for regular physical activity to maintain balance and prevent disease. The book discusses the benefits of yoga, pranayama (breathwork), and other forms of exercise for overall well-being.

  6. Stress Management: Stress is considered a significant factor in disease according to Ayurveda. The book offers techniques for managing stress, including mindfulness, relaxation practices, and herbal remedies.

  7. Detoxification and Cleansing: Ayurveda emphasizes the importance of periodic detoxification to rid the body of accumulated toxins (ama) and restore balance. The book discusses various detoxification practices, such as fasting, cleansing diets, and herbal formulas.

  8. Herbal Medicine and Remedies: Ayurveda utilizes a variety of herbs and natural remedies to promote health and treat imbalances. The book provides information on common Ayurvedic herbs and their therapeutic properties.

  9. Mind-Body Connection: Ayurveda recognizes the intimate connection between the mind and body. The book explores techniques for cultivating mental clarity, emotional balance, and spiritual well-being, such as meditation, mindfulness, and self-reflection.

  10. Holistic Approach to Health: Overall, Ayurveda promotes a holistic approach to health that considers all aspects of an individual's life, including diet, lifestyle, emotions, and environment. By incorporating Ayurvedic principles into daily life, readers can achieve greater balance, vitality, and longevity.
